[Soot lung as occupational disease].
Summary
Workers in a carbon black plant developed lung disease due to high dust exposure. Examination revealed carbon black accumulation and collagen fibers, consistent with occupational pneumoconiosis.

Context:
- Workers in carbon black production facilities face significant exposure to respirable dust.
- Previous studies have indicated potential respiratory health risks associated with carbon black exposure.
Purpose:
- To investigate and characterize the lung findings in workers exposed to carbon black.
- To determine if the observed lung pathology constitutes a form of pneumoconiosis.
Summary:
- Lung X-rays of 13 carbon black plant workers revealed disseminated shadows indicating slow disease progression.
- Histological examination of lung tissue showed carbon black particle accumulation and collagen fiber development.
- The observed lung disease was classified as pneumoconiosis, linked to occupational dust exposure.
Impact:
- Highlights the risk of occupational lung disease in the carbon black industry.
- Supports the classification of carbon black-induced lung disease as a compensable occupational illness.
- Emphasizes the need for workplace safety measures and potential legal recognition for affected workers.
